Print Design Analysis

When I review business card print designs, I look for a balance between professionalism and modern appeal.
The InstaSwitch identity is a great example of this principle.
- Typography: The bold geometric wordmark establishes authority, and I think the subtle angular cuts in the letter “S” are an elegant nod to the brand's promise of speed.
- Imagery & Symbol: The central mark has a clever dual meaning. It reads as both a bolt of lightning and the number one, reinforcing agility in a single gesture.
- Color Palette: Navy blue is used to build a foundation of trust. Teal is added to bring a feeling of freshness. Together, they project fintech reliability with a modern edge.
- Layout: The card uses clean alignment and generous breathing space. This minimalist approach supports brand confidence and sophistication.
What Brands & Agencies Can Learn from InstaSwitch
This design provides a strong blueprint for creating a memorable first impression.
1. Create a Symbol with Two Meanings
A great icon can communicate on multiple levels. Try to develop a mark that has both a literal and a conceptual meaning. This adds a layer of depth that makes your brand more memorable.
2. Pair a Traditional Color with a Modern One
To signal both trustworthiness and innovation, combine a classic corporate color like navy blue with a fresh, digital-native accent like teal.
3. Prioritize Space on a Small Canvas
White space is crucial on a business card. A clean, uncluttered layout feels more confident and sophisticated than one packed with information.
